Browse Source

search cancel

deepsea 1 năm trước cách đây
mục cha
commit
b994003d93
2 tập tin đã thay đổi với 6 bổ sung0 xóa
  1. 2 0
      src/components/SearchBar/index.vue
  2. 4 0
      src/views/ordinaryPage/index.vue

+ 2 - 0
src/components/SearchBar/index.vue

@@ -13,6 +13,7 @@
       :value="value"
       @focus="onFocus"
       @input="onInput"
+      @blur="onBlur"
     />
     <!-- <div v-show="show" @click="onBlur" class="el-icon-close closeBtn"></div> -->
     <div class="jumpBtnBox">
@@ -49,6 +50,7 @@ export default {
     },
     onBlur() {
       this.show = false;
+      console.log('=======-------======')
       this.$emit("blur");
     },
     goBack() {

+ 4 - 0
src/views/ordinaryPage/index.vue

@@ -6,6 +6,7 @@
         v-model="inputValue"
         @focus="onFocus"
         @input="onInput"
+        @blur="onBlur"
         ref="searchbar"
       />
       <div class="square-map" v-show="isOpenSquare">
@@ -1131,6 +1132,9 @@ export default {
     onFocus() {
       this.isOpen = true;
     },
+    onBlur() {
+      this.isOpen = false;
+    },
     onInput(value) {
       this.inputValue = value;
     },